I checked in game and it takes Persia 3 turns to irrigate, 2 turns to road, & 4 turns to mine. I believe in C3C, that the IND was changed from 200% efficiency to 150% efficiency. Either way, I have a spreadsheet with irrigating in 2 and another in 3 just in case. Depending on when the cow is irrigated, I'll use the appropriate spreadsheet.
The pic is from CivAssist 2. It'll show you a world map and everything even if the save that is loaded is not technically your turn. I thought that it might be of use to you since you will go first.
